From 93dec51e716db88f32d770dc9ab268964fff320b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Yu Kuai Date: Wed, 3 Sep 2025 09:41:40 +0800 Subject: [PATCH 1/2] md/raid1: fix data lost for writemostly rdev If writemostly is enabled, alloc_behind_master_bio() will allocate a new bio for rdev, with bi_opf set to 0. Later, raid1_write_request() will clone from this bio, hence bi_opf is still 0 for the cloned bio. Submit this cloned bio will end up to be read, causing write data lost. Fix this problem by inheriting bi_opf from original bio for behind_mast_bio. This causes 'curr_resync' (and later 'recovery_offset') to be set to MaxSector too, which incorrectly signals that recovery/resync has completed, even though disk data has not actually been updated. To fix this issue, skip updating any offset values when the sync action is FROZEN. The same holds true for IDLE.
